I posted some of this in the thread about his death, but want to elaborate more.

I got the opportunity to work with this great man in 2006. I was hired as an assistant engineer for the Newman Wachs Champ Car Atlantic team. This was a very young team started by Newman and Eddie Wachs to help develop drivers for the Champ Car World series. It was also a place that young engineers could get experience in the world of professional motorsports.
